Sights You’ll See from the Sky

This helicopter tour review wouldn’t be complete without diving into the incredible landmarks you’ll witness. The Manhattan Helicopter Tour of New York packs an impressive amount of sightseeing into 12 thrilling minutes.

The Statue of Liberty

The crown jewel of this tour is undoubtedly the up-close view of the Statue of Liberty. Lady Liberty looks absolutely magnificent from the air, and you’ll get angles that ferry passengers simply can’t access. Watching the morning sun illuminate her copper-green surface is genuinely moving—even for this seasoned travel professional.

One World Observatory and the Financial District

Soaring past One World Observatory at the top of One World Trade Center gives you a profound appreciation for modern engineering. At 1,776 feet, it dominates the skyline, and seeing it from helicopter height puts its scale into perspective. The entire Financial District spreads out below like a glittering canyon of glass and steel.

Empire State Building and Chrysler Building

These Art Deco masterpieces remain the most photographed buildings in Manhattan, and for good reason. From your helicopter, you’ll see the Empire State Building’s distinctive silhouette alongside the Chrysler Building’s gleaming silver crown. Have your camera ready—these shots are absolute gold.

Central Park

Nothing prepares you for how stunning Central Park looks from above. This 843-acre green rectangle surrounded by towering buildings is a sight that simply can’t be replicated from ground level. You’ll spot the reservoir, the Great Lawn, and the winding paths that make this urban oasis so beloved.

Chelsea Piers, The Intrepid Museum, and Times Square

Your flight path takes you past Chelsea Piers along the Hudson River, giving you views of the historic Intrepid Museum with its aircraft carrier and submarine. As you pass over Midtown, you’ll glimpse the neon wonderland of Times Square from a perspective few ever experience.

Need-to-Know Info Before You Fly

The Manhattan Helicopter Tour of New York - Breathtaking aerial view of New York City skyline at night featuring iconic skyscrapers.
Photo by Hamza Kibar on Pexels

Before booking The Manhattan Helicopter Tour of New York, here’s the practical information you’ll need:

Weight and Seating: Passengers are seated based on weight distribution for safety. Be prepared to share your weight during booking—it’s standard practice for all helicopter operations.

What to Wear: Dress comfortably and in layers. While the cabin is climate-controlled, you’ll want to avoid loose accessories like scarves or hats that could become problematic.

Photography: Bring your camera or smartphone—you’ll absolutely want to capture these views. The doors stay on for this tour, giving you clear, protected shots through the windows.

Accessibility: I’m pleased to report this tour is wheelchair accessible with service animals allowed, making it one of the more inclusive helicopter experiences available. Public transportation is nearby, making arrival convenient.

Meeting Point: Head to Charm Aviation NYC at the Downtown Manhattan Heliport, 6 E River Piers, New York, NY 10004. It’s easily accessible and well-marked.

The Best Times to Book

For The Manhattan Helicopter Tour of New York, timing can significantly impact your experience. Here’s what I recommend based on seasons and conditions:

Spring (April-May): Gorgeous weather, Central Park in bloom, comfortable temperatures. This is prime time for the best New York helicopter tour experience.

Summer (June-August): Longest daylight hours mean more scheduling flexibility. Early morning or late afternoon flights avoid the midday haze that can develop over the city.

Fall (September-November): Absolutely spectacular when Central Park’s foliage turns golden and red. The crisp air typically means excellent visibility.

Winter (December-February): Cold but often crystal-clear skies. Holiday decorations visible from above add extra magic to your flight.
